What happens when it starts to feel like you’re the only one trying?
In this episode of The Backdoor Podcast, we’re diving into the effort gap — that frustrating, often unspoken dynamic where one person feels like they’re putting in more time, energy, and care than the other. From initiating conversations and intimacy to planning, supporting, and showing up consistently, we’re breaking down what it really means when effort feels one-sided.
Is it a lack of love… or just a lack of awareness?
In this episode we discuss:
The signs you’re in a one-sided effort dynamic
Why effort drops in long-term relationships
How men and women define “effort” differently
The resentment that builds when effort feels unbalanced
How to communicate needs without sounding like you’re keeping score
If you’ve ever thought “I care more than they do” or felt emotionally drained from always being the one trying — this episode gives honest insight into why it happens and how couples can fix it before the relationship starts to break down.
